PURPOSE: A pneumatic active engine mount system and a controlling method for the same are provided to effectively reduce vibration by approving a PWM(Pulse Width Modulation) signal as a controlling signal for driving a solenoid valve.;CONSTITUTION: A pneumatic active engine mount system comprises an engine mount, a vacuum tank, a solenoid valve(150), and a controlling unit(100). The engine mount is installed between an engine and a car body. The vacuum tank stores negative pressure for the engine mount. The solenoid valve delivers the negative pressure to the engine mount by opening and closing the fluid passage of the vacuum tank. The controlling unit comprises an air conditioner status determination unit(110), and gear state determination unit(120), and a RPM(Revolutions Per Minute) input unit(130). The air conditioner determination unit determines whether an air conditioner is on or off by being inputted the driving voltage of a vehicle air conditioner. The gear determination unit determines the N, D, R status of a gear according to the output value of a shift position sensor.
